    I stood in the threshold
    watching God
    my eyes and heart
    yearned to be near God

    So I asked My God
    What can I do
    so I can always
    bw with You

    God said to me with kindness
    in His eyes, My Child
    You have to finish
    all your bad karmas
    and then come back to ME

    How can this be done My God
    I asked and wondered
    To which He replied with Love
    I will send all my angels
    to give enough trouble
    that you can bless them with love

    How would I ever handle
    all the problems My God
    for I am all alone.
    Dear Child He said
    I will always be with you my dear
    so Never Fear till
    you come back and reach me near

    When I wake up to see my husband
    I know at that moment
    God did keep up his word
    And is walking with me every step
    And for every problem I have to face
    I do so with love and kindness
    so as to move closer a step to God.
